I have a quick question for you...is there a limit on how many tacacs-server I can have on a router? I mean currently I have:
tacacs-server host 192.168.11.10 single-conneciton
tacacs-server host 192.168.21.53 single-conneciton
can I add another one without killing anything?
tacacs-server host 192.168.51.27 single-conneciton

Yes, adding the .27 server to the already existing list of TACACS Server will not kill anything. You can use multiple tacacs-server host commands to specify additional hosts. The Cisco IOS software searches for hosts in the order in which you specify them.
